Telus Communications Tower - Skeetchestn First Nation

Telus Communications Inc. is proposing the installation of a new guyed radiocommunication antenna tower, 102 meters in height as a new telecommunications facility, located on Skeetchestn Reserve, B.C. The tower will include six (6) initial (8 ft.) antennas that will provide cellular, and data services in the area. 

An Impact Assessment Act federal lands review was previously conducted by ISED for this project in 2025.  The project page for that review can be found here: https://iaac-aeic.gc.ca/050/evaluations/proj/89577

NOTICE OF INTENT TO MAKE A DETERMINATION

Telus Communications Tower - Skeetchestn First Nation – Public Comments Invited

 

May 04, 2026 – Indigenous Services Canada must determine whether the proposed Telus Communications Tower, located in Skeetchestn First Nation is likely to cause significant adverse environmental effects. To help inform this determination, Indigenous Services Canada is inviting comments from the public respecting that determination.

 

Written comments must be submitted by June 05, 2026 to the BC Environment Team.
